Pros and Cons...
Pros:
Smore is a website that is easy for students to navigate through and organize information on a select topic.
You can choose from a variety of backgrounds, colors, and fonts.
Provides an easy way to save and share information through email or social media account.
Cons:
Students would have to upload images from a outside source to use in their flyer.
There's only a limited amount of editing that you can do within a format, and it will only show a small amount of an uploaded photo.
Smore is a way to organize information, but doesn't lend itself to research.

How can I use this in my classroom?
Students could use Smore to create a flyer illustrating the processes of conduction, convection, and radiation. Students would be required to define each process, provide graphics that represent each process as well as compare/contrast them.
